Mazda Motor Corporation has released a four-wheel-drive (4WD) version of the all-new Mazda Premacy (known overseas as the all-new Mazda5), a stylish, versatile and uniquely functional seven-seat minivan. The 4WD Premacy is available in two model grades and goes on sale today at all Mazda, Mazda Anfini, and Mazda Autozam dealerships nationwide. Manufacturer’s suggested retail prices range from 2,109,000 to 2,314,000 yen, including sales taxes.

The 4WD drivetrain mated to Mazda’s MZR 2.0-liter DOHC engine provides the all-new Premacy with confidence-inspiring maneuverability and power. The four-wheel-drive system automatically distributes power between the front and rear axles to ensure outstanding drivability on all kinds of road surfaces. Drivers can select front-wheel drive or four-wheel drive mode with the push of a button. Both model grades also feature heated door mirrors as standard equipment.
